Exciting activities for every subject
Into Europe provides a carefully structured range of activity outlines and worksheets closely linked to core and other foundation subjects at Key Stage 2. Activity outlines include:
- English – Campaign speeches and debates for the European Parliament simulated in the classroom, plus wide-ranging activities based on European classics: The Odyssey, Pinocchio, Don Quixote and Robinson Crusoe
- Maths – measurement, statistics and investigations based on climate, population, and land area data
- Art and Design – European art from cave paintings to modern times, including international posters and flags
- Music –Tuneful and accessible international songs and jingles
- Science and Technology –Dscoveries of great Europeans
- Religious Education –European celebrations and icons.
Background information includes: History of the European Union; How the EU is governed; Member states; European foods; Flags of the EU.
